Title
Sentry Seer vulnerability allows attacker-controlled input to be executed in a privileged environment
Summary
Sentry Seer is vulnerable to a multi-stage trust-boundary violation that allows unauthenticated attacker-controlled telemetry to become code that is executed by an agent in a privileged automation environment. An external attacker can submit fabricated Sentry events without having access to the victim’s Sentry account, source repository, or infrastructure.
